Abstract
The present invention provides a positioning method, an online charging system and a positioning service system, relating to the field of communication. The method comprises a step of obtaining the charging request information of user conversation sent by a service control point, a step of extracting the position information of a user from the charging request information, a step of storing the extracted position information of the user into a database, and a step of using the position information of the user in the database to provide the positioning service for the user. According to the scheme of the invention, the conversation position of the user can be rapidly positioned, and the practical value is high.

Embodiment
For making the technical problem to be solved in the present invention, technical scheme and advantage clearly, be described in detail below in conjunction with the accompanying drawings and the specific embodiments.
As shown in Figure 1, embodiments of the invention provide a kind of localization method being applied to Online Charging System, comprising:
Step 11, obtains the billing information request of the user's communication that service control point sends;
Step 12, extracts the positional information of user from described billing information request;
Step 13, is saved to database by the positional information of the described user extracted;
Step 14, utilizes the positional information of the described user in described database to provide positioning service for described user.
Call in process current user, SCP (the ServiceControlPoint at user place, service control point) need the accounting request of applying for this call to OCS (Online Charging System), according to 3GPP agreement regulation, accounting request comprises the information such as numbers of calling and called parties, numbers of calling and called parties, event, customer location.OCS is according to the information in accounting request, and the charging regulation of coupling call, determines the duration that user can use, and reply to SCP.SCP, according to this reply, triggers related signaling, determines user's communication state.According to the description of 3GPP to this process, the accounting request of the call that OCS is just concrete does not do any record.For this reason, the localization method of the present embodiment improves OCS, when obtain billing information request that SCP sends to after, OCS to this billing information request except doing normal answer, also the customer position information in billing information request is preserved, for the positioning service providing user in call.Geographical position during user's communication can be known quickly and accurately.
Particularly, positional information when localization method of the present invention can be conversed according to user provides real-time positioning service, also can provide history positioning service according to the positional information that the call of user's history is corresponding by normal root.
Wherein, above-mentioned database comprises: cache database and historical data base; Cache database preserves positional information corresponding when user converses, and historical data base is for preserving the positional information corresponding to the call of user's history.
And in above-mentioned steps 13, specifically comprise:
Step 131, when described call is carried out, by the positional information buffer memory of user that extracts from described billing information request to described cache database;
Step 132, after described call completes, is saved to historical data base by the positional information of the user in described cache database.
Wherein, when concrete execution step 131, first determine whether described cache database exists the positional information of the described user of buffer memory; If there is not the positional information of the described user of buffer memory in described cache database, then by the positional information buffer memory of user that extracts from described billing information request to described cache database; If there is the positional information of the described user of buffer memory in described cache database, then the positional information of the described user of this cache database is saved to historical data base, and is the positional information of the described user extracted from described billing information request by the updating location information of the user of described cache database.
Corresponding, in above-mentioned steps 14, if obtain the first Location Request of the described user's current location information of inquiry when described call is carried out, then complete the positioning service of described first Location Request according to the positional information of the described user in described cache database; If obtain the second Location Request of the described user's historical position information of inquiry, then complete the positioning service of described second Location Request according to the positional information of the described user in storehouse according to described history.

Describe in detail below in conjunction with the system of practical application scene to the present embodiment.
< application scenarios one >
In application scenarios one, suppose that user has an accident in driving procedure, and dial seek help call request rescue, the execution step of corresponding positioning service system of the present invention as shown in Figure 3:
SCP (service control point), after receiving the call request of seeking help that user dials, sends billing information request to OCS (line charge system).
OCS by the customer position information buffer memory in billing information request to cache database.
OCS completes the charging configuration of phone of seeking help, and responds accounting request to SCP.The relief phone of user is successfully connected.
In salvor and user's communication process, directly can be sent first Location Request of described user by application server to OCS, the identification information of user can be included in this first Location Request, as subscriber directory number etc.;
OCS, after receiving the first Location Request, confirms user identity by its identification information, and the positional information of current talking to data cached this user of library inquiry;
The positional information of the user's current talking inquired is sent to application server by OCS, makes salvor's quick position go out customer location.
Succour after phone hangs up user, the positional information of the user in cache database is saved to historical data base by OCS.
Can be known by the description of above-mentioned application scenarios one, positioning service system of the present invention can orient the talking position of user rapidly and accurately, especially under Emergency Assistance scene, for person for help has striven for the valuable time.
< application scenarios two >
In application scenarios two, when supposing that user obtains the restaurant of recommending by the life kind application software of mobile phone, the execution step of corresponding positioning service system of the present invention as shown in Figure 4:
Application software sends second Location Request of described user to OCS by application server, can include the identification information of user, as subscriber directory number etc. in this second Location Request;
OCS, after receiving the second Location Request, confirms user identity by its identification information, and to the positional information that this user's history of historical data library inquiry is conversed;
The positional information that the user's history inquired is conversed is sent to application server by OCS;
Application server determines according to the positional information that history is conversed the place that user often goes, and to the restaurant near the place that user recommends this often to go.
Can be known by the description of above-mentioned application scenarios two, positioning service system of the present invention can orient the positional information of user's history call rapidly and accurately, and the positional information of user's history call can derive abundant and have the service of practical value, therefore there is very high prospect of the application.
